The ingredients needed to cook Chocolate Babka bread (vegan):
  1. Get for dough :
  2. Use 1 cup wheat flour
  3. Use 1 cup all purpose flour
  4. Use 1 tbsp granulated sugar
  5. Use 3 tbsp powdered sugar
  6. Use 1 pinch salt
  7. Prepare 1 +1/4 tbsp active dry yeast
  8. Take 1 tsp vanilla extract
  9. Get 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  10. Take 1/2 cup warm water
  11. Prepare for filling :
  12. Take 30 grams dark chocolate
  13. Provide 5 tbsp unsweetened cocoa powder
  14. You need 4 tbsp brown sugar
  15. Use 1 tbsp melted coconut oil
  16. Use 1 tbsp almond milk or any milk of your choice
  17. Get 1/2 tsp cinnamon powder
  18. Take 2-3 tbsp roughly chopped walnuts
  19. You need for sugar syrup :
  20. Take 1/2 cup water
  21. Take 1/2 cup sugar
Steps to make Chocolate Babka bread (vegan):
  1. In a big mixing bowl combine whole wheat flour, all purpose flour, salt and powdered sugar and mix well. - Now make a small depression (round) in the centre and pour warm water in it. Add granulated sugar and yeast to it. Leave it for 5 minutes. - Now add the oil and vanilla extract to the yeast and make a slurry.
  2. Now using your hands mix the yeast with the flour mixture and knead a dough. - Transfer the dough on a lightly floured work surface and knead for 4-5 minutes until the dough becomes soft and smooth. Then make a round ball of the dough. - Put the dough in a lightly greased bowl. Cover it with a cloth and let it rise for about 1- 1.5 hours or until it has almost doubled in volume.
  3. Meanwhile prepare the filling. Combine all the ingredients listed in filling section(except cinnamon powder and walnuts) in a microwave safe bowl and microwave on medium-high for one minute and then take it out and using a whisk mix well. - Microwave again for a minute, take it out and mix well.
  4. Let the chocolate sauce cool and then keep it refrigerated until required. - When the dough has doubled in volume knock it down with a fist and on a floured surface roll it into a rectangle with 1/2 cm thickness.
  5. Now spread half of the chocolate mixture and spread evenly on the rolled dough leaving 1" border on each side. - Sprinkle cinnamon powder evenly over the chocolate spread followed by chopped walnuts. - Roll the dough into a tight log.
  6. Take a sharp knife and cut the log lengthwise. Then twist each piece and make an X as a braid. Then seal each end properly by pinching it under the braid. - Lift the log gently and carefully and put it into a lined 9" loaf pan and cover it with a samp cloth and keep it in a warm place to let rise until it doubles in volume.
  7. Preheat the oven at 180°c. - Brush the loaf with almond milk. - Bake for about 30-40 minutes or until the bread gets a beautiful golden brown colour. Take it out and let it cool. - Meanwhile prepare the sugar syrup. For the syrup boil sugar and water in a sauce pan until the sugar dissolves completely. - Brush the Babka with this syrup generously or pour a little at a time all over the bread and let it cool.
  8. Slice it and drizzle some chocolate sauce over it and serve warm. - Notes : Always serve the bread warm. - Don't skip the sugar syrup it keeps the bread soft and moist. - Babka can be stored in the refrigerator wrapped in a foil up to 4 days. - You can even make sweet French toasts using Babka. It tastes amazing. - You can try different nuts and fruits as a filling.

A Babka is a spongy, brioche-like yeast pastry popular in Eastern Europe. East European immigrants brought it along with them to Israel where it can be found in practically any neighborhood bakery I decided to veganize it and the end result is a vegan Babka just as perfect as its non-vegan sister!
